Mary Anne Fehr (nee Sawatzky)

Suddenly, on the morning of March 15, 2022, Mary Anne Fehr passed away peacefully to join her family and friends in Heaven. Mary Anne was predeceased by her parents, Abram & Helena Sawatzky of Grunthal, MB and her in-laws, Henry & Katharina of Winkler, MB, along with brothers-in-law Larry and Abe and niece Deborah.

Her loving husband of 49 years, John, will miss her dearly. Also left to celebrate her memory are her children and grandchildren, Tracy & Angie (Kaylee, Tristan, Tanner), Darcy & Christina (Caetlyn, Aedyn), Curtis & Milenys (Patricia), Clarice & Stuart (Juliana, Jillian), and Duane & Kim (Kelsie, David, Adam).

She is also survived by her siblings, Betty, Ed (Lina), Pete, Alvin (Blu), Kim (Frank); and siblings-in-law, Helen, Henry (Mary), Abe (Sylvia), Mary (Tony), Kathy (Robert), Betty (Scott), Margery (Ron), and Sharon (Charles). She will also be lovingly remembered by numerous nephews, nieces, aunts, uncles, cousins, friends, co-workers, and everyone who ever met her.

Mom was born on December 13th, 1953 in her grandparent’s home in New Bothwell, Manitoba. She had many hobbies including reading, traveling, organizing (everything), but her greatest passion and pride was her family. She kept a family tree that rivalled any ancestry website. Grandma Mary Anne was the root system that fed every branch of an enormous family, which included her immediate family, extended family, a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.

Mary Anne was very loyal to her career at the Wellness Institute where she spent over 20 years in the job she loved. The family extends our sincerest appreciation to everyone at the Wellness Institute and Seven Oaks General Hospital for everything.
